Apple has introduced its latest Mac Studio desktop, featuring the new M5 Max and M5 Ultra processors, targeting professionals who demand top-tier performance for artificial intelligence and intensive creative workflows. Announced on August 25, 2026, the update positions the Mac Studio as Apple’s most powerful desktop to date, designed to handle complex local AI tasks and extreme pro applications with unprecedented speed and efficiency.

These processors feature enhanced neural engines and unified memory architecture, supporting configurations up to 512GB of RAM. Apple emphasized that the system enables on-device AI processing at scale, reducing reliance on cloud services while maintaining data privacy and low latency. Improved graphics capabilities also benefit video editors, 3D artists, and developers working with machine learning models.

The M5 Ultra chip integrates a 64-core neural engine capable of executing up to 200 trillion operations per second, a significant leap from earlier models. This allows users to run large language models and diffusion models directly on the Mac Studio without noticeable lag. Apple highlighted that developers can now train and fine-tune AI models locally using frameworks like Core ML and TensorFlow Metal, accelerating iteration cycles. The increased memory bandwidth ensures smooth handling of massive datasets, a critical factor for researchers and enterprise AI teams.
The Mac Studio includes a comprehensive array of ports, featuring Thunderbolt 5, HDMI 2.1, USB-A, and an SDXC card slot, supporting up to six external displays including multiple 8K monitors. This extensive connectivity reduces the need for docks or adapters in professional studios. Apple also improved thermal design to sustain peak performance during prolonged workloads, ensuring reliability during rendering, simulation, or AI inference tasks. The system starts at a higher price point reflecting its advanced components, targeting users who require uncompromised desktop power.
